About Serena Lee

Serena K. Lee is the current President and CEO of the International Institute for Conflict Prevention & Resolution (CPR), a think tank started in 1977 with a mission to help businesses (and all its stakeholders including in house and outside counsel, academics and neturals) identify ways to prevent and resolve disputes in a fair, efficient and thoughtful manner. Visit www.cpradr.org for more information on CPR. Serena is an expert in the field of alternative dispute resolution (ADR), an accomplished business development professional and a legal professional licensed in New York State. Serena possesses a strong understanding of strategic and efficient use of alternative dispute resolution (ADR) processes, business development tools and networking to skillfully promote and communicate new ideas and implement innovative solutions. Serena is a multi-talented relationship builder and leader with an entrepreneurial spirit and a proven, successful track record as an effective and assertive negotiator, communicator and problem solver. Serena is an experienced and effective speaker and trainer, comfortable with addressing industry and professional groups of all sizes. She often speaks on topics related to alternative dispute resolution processes such as mediation and arbitration. She is a frequent presenter at regional and national legal and business conferences and local universities.Specialties: Arbitration and mediation processes, alternative dispute resolution (ADR) design, training and seminars related to arbitration and mediation, construction and real estate industry dispute resolution, advertising (print and broadcast), media buying and planning, media contract negotiations, media campaign analyses, and social media marketing.

Serving as the CEO and President of the International Institute for Conflict Prevention and Resolution (CPR), a mission and member-driven organization that seeks to help others manage conflict so they might pursue their purpose and lessen the costs, financial and otherwise, of disputes. CPR endeavors to bring together the thought leaders of dispute resolution with the stakeholders, including business leaders, general counsel and academics, to identify emerging areas of disputes and to exploring possible solutions to resolve conflict in fair, economic and practical ways.Additionally, the CPR Dispute Resolution Services (drs.cpradr.org) endeavors to harness the insights and experiences of CPR Institute members to prevent and resolve business disputes by providing an array of dispute resolution services and a curated roster of neutrals, the CPR Panel of Distinguished Neutrals, to provide collaborative, quality conflict management.
